Lecture Overview

Chapter 8 introduces Magnetism, a new addition to the 9th class syllabus. This opening lecture covers the fundamental properties of magnets and distinguishes between materials that interact with magnetic fields and those that do not.

Main Concepts Explained by the Teacher

Sir defines magnetic materials (like iron, nickel, and cobalt) as substances that are attracted to a magnet, while non-magnetic materials (like wood, plastic, and copper) are unaffected. The teacher then explains the core properties of a bar magnet, demonstrating that it always has two distinct poles (North and South).

Important Definitions and Terms

  • Magnetic Material: A material that experiences a force when placed in a magnetic field.
  • Magnetic Poles: The two ends of a magnet where the magnetic force is concentrated (North-seeking and South-seeking).
  • Law of Magnetism: Like poles repel each other; unlike poles attract each other.

Key Points and Lists from the Lecture

  • Iron, steel, nickel, and cobalt are the primary magnetic metals.
  • A freely suspended magnet will always align itself in the North-South geographic direction.
  • Magnetic monopoles do not exist; breaking a magnet simply creates two smaller magnets, each with its own N and S pole.

What Students Should Remember

So basically, The most heavily tested concept is the Law of Magnetism (Like poles repel, Unlike poles attract). Furthermore, a common trick question is whether copper or aluminum are magnetic—students must remember that they are non-magnetic metals.
